National Nurse-Led Care Consortium

The National Nurse-Led Care Consortium (NNCC) supports nurse-led care and nurses at the front lines of care. Because of their education and their community connections, advanced practice nurses today are able to deliver high quality and cost-effective services to our most vulnerable populations, the poor and the uninsured. Our member health clinics, run by nurse practitioners, demonstrate this by providing community-based care that is sensitive to patient needs and concerns. NNCC works to help member health clinics meet the costs of providing care to the uninsured and underinsured.  NNCC provides expertise to support comprehensive, community-based primary care. Comprehensive primary care goes beyond a provider visit.  NNCC takes the lead in developing and running community programs, in partnership with member clinics, which help people lead healthier and safer lives. These programs help avert future health problems and keep healthcare costs from rising further.

Our mission:To advance nurse-led health care through policy, consultation, and programs to reduce health disparities and meet people’s primary care and wellness needs. 

We accomplish our mission by:

  1. providing national leadership in identifying, tracking, and advising healthcare policy development;
  2. positioning nurse-managed health clinics as a recognized mainstream health care model; and
  3. fostering partnerships with people and groups who share common goals.
